The adoption process

Four steps to a new best friend

Filling out an application doesn't guarantee placement β€” think of it as the first step in telling us what you're looking for in a companion. For the welfare of our dogs, appointments are always required to meet dogs during open hours.

Browse available animals

See who's looking for a home right now β€” dogs, cats, rabbits, birds, and little pets, updated live from our shelter.

Meet the animals

Submit an application online

Tell us about your home and what you're hoping for. Our adoption counselors review every application to help make a great match.

Meet your match

Visit during open hours (Tue–Sat, 11–3:30). Cat and small-animal visits are walk-in; dog visits are by appointment so we can set every introduction up for success.

Take them home

Every adoption includes a full vet workup (see below). Thanks to our partners at IPJ Real Estate, dogs go home with a complimentary leash & collar and cats with a cardboard carrier.

Adoption fees

What adoption costs β€” and why

Adoption fees help offset the care every animal receives before going home. We estimate our investment in each animal available for adoption to be at least $500.

🐱 Cats & Kittens
Kitten (0–12 months)$200
Adult cat (1–7 years)$165
Senior cat (8+ years)$75
Special-needs catBy donation
Working cat$50 min. donation
Bonded pair of adult cats$225 ($105 off)
Senior-to-Senior (adopter 60+)$25 min. donation
🐢 Dogs & Puppies
Puppy (0–6 months)$500
Puppy (7–12 months)$400
Adult dog (1–7 years)$325
Senior dog (8+ years)$175
Special-needs dog$100
Bonded pair of adult dogs$475 ($125 off)
Senior-to-Senior (adopter 60+)$50 min. donation
Included with every adoption

Your new pet arrives ready to thrive

Every Homeward Bound adoption includes hundreds of dollars of veterinary care and support β€” already done, already covered.

Need affordable vet care after adoption? Meet PetFIX

  • βœ” In-house veterinary exam
  • βœ” Spay / neuter if needed
  • βœ” FeLV/FIV or heartworm testing
  • βœ” Age-appropriate core vaccines
  • βœ” Parasite treatment
  • βœ” Transitional food
  • βœ” Microchip
  • βœ” Free exam voucher at a participating vet
  • βœ” Free post-adoption support
  • βœ” Leash & collar (dogs) / carrier (cats)
Paws on the Job

Adopt a working cat

Some cats don't fit a traditional living-room life β€” and they make wonderful, eco-friendly rodent patrol for barns, warehouses, stables, breweries, stores, and offices.

🐭

Natural pest control

Non-toxic, eco-friendly rodent control that keeps your space cleaner β€” no chemicals required.

πŸ’š

Good for everyone

Studies link cats to lower stress and better morale. You also save a life and free up shelter space.

🩺

Fully vetted

Every working cat is spayed/neutered, microchipped, vaccinated, and FeLV/FIV tested before placement.

The fee is whatever you feel your new working cat is worth β€” pay by donation. Working cats are a lifetime commitment: they still need shelter, food, water, medical care, and affection. We won't place an indoor-only cat into an outdoor-only role. For truly feral or barn cats, see our Trap-Neuter-Return program.
